Abstract
The production of porous or cellular concrete or mortar by aeration is facilitated by the incorporation of an extract of mineral oil refinery sludges with alcohol. This extract contains sulphonated hydrocarbons and a small proportion of unsulphonated hydrocarbons which in the presence of sulphonic acids form colloidal solutions in water, and may be made by agitating refinery sludge for 1/2 -2 hours with 100-300 per cent of hot ethyl alcohol or methylated spirit, removing the solution and evaporating the solvent. A suitable proportion is 0.3-1 lb. to 100 lbs. of Portland cement, and 250-350 lbs. of aggregate and sand. Light fillers such as wood flour may also be added.
